This Australian beauty, with her long hair and sparking blue eyes is full of surprises. What initially appears is not at all what it seems when it comes to Tahlia as she flicks back her lovely locks and pushes up her glasses. In fact, Tahlia is somewhat of a vixen when it comes to her […]